Belgium: Ann Veronica Janssens Exhibition in M Woods Museum

Chargée d'Affaires Sophie Hottat at the Belgian Embassy in China visited the M Woods Museum in the 798 art district, Beijing, to take part in the opening ceremony of the first solo exhibition in China of Belgian artist Ann Veronica Janssens titled "pinkyellowblue."

Ann Veronica Janssens was born in 1956 in Folkestone, the United Kingdom. 

Janssens studied at the Brussels National School for Visual Arts of La Cambre, then permanently settled in Brussels where she has since been creating art for exhibitions all over the world. Janssens' works vary from sculptures to installations, videos, and even photos. Hottat noted the role of art in fostering connections between cultures and peoples: Art, and more specifically Janssens's art, does not need a knowledge of any language or cultural background to be understood. As such, it holds the inherent power to build bridges between cultures that are vastly different, especially when cultural and people-to-people contacts are difficult.

Home buyers, property sector bolstered by rate cut on existing mortgages

With interest rates for existing mortgages for first-home purchases lowered starting from Monday, some 40 millions borrowers in China will enjoy the benefit of this support policy in the property sector. The move is expected to spur consumption and investment amid current economic headwinds, experts said.

The term "interest rates of existing mortgages for first-home purchases lowered from Monday" hit the hot searches on Chinese social media Weibo on Monday morning.

Most home buyers received text messages from banks or sought information on banks' apps. The reductions vary by the city, the time of purchase and the time when the credit contract was signed with the bank.

Mortgage interest rates in big cities are generally higher, and the total loan amounts are also higher. Buyers in such cities will see their payments fall more than those in smaller ones.

People who bought apartments in 2021, when mortgage policies were tightened and interest rates were relatively high, will more clearly feel the positive effects of rate cuts this time, according to Yan Yuejin, research director at Shanghai-based E-house China R&D Institute.

"The adjustment of mortgage rates could represent a significant innovation in housing policies. Market sentiment has been quite positive on the first day of the policy's implementation," Yan told the Global Times on Monday.

"Everyone is very supportive of the national policy, which has genuinely brought benefits to people, and their confidence in the real estate market has been further bolstered," Yan noted.

A house owner surnamed Bai, who bought a house in 2021 in Guangzhou, capital of South China's Guangdong Province, told the Global Times on Monday that he could save as much as 1,000 yuan ($136.8) per month after the adjustment.

Prior to the adjustment, Bai's mortgage rate was 120 basis points above the loan prime rates (LPR), a market-based benchmark lending rate. Now the rate is the same as the LPR, which is 4.3 percent, he was told by the bank.

"That will effectively reduce my monthly financial burden, which makes me very happy and more motivated to work harder and spend more to improve my living conditions," Bai said.

The move announced on Monday will help reduce borrowers' mortgage interest payments, stabilize and expand housing demand, and promote the sound and stable development of the country's real estate market, Dong Ximiao, chief research fellow at Merchants Union Consumer Finance Co, told the Global Times on Monday.

"It will also help narrow the interest rate gaps between existing mortgage loans and new loans, and ease the early mortgage payment rush," Dong said, adding that the risk from mortgage irregularities will also be diminished.

From a long-term view, these changes will later translate into consumption and willingness to invest, he noted.

The lowering of mortgage rates will benefit about 40 million borrowers. If the interest rate of a 1 million yuan mortgage for a 25-year term is cut from 5.1 percent to 4.3 percent, borrowers' interest payments will drop by over 5,000 yuan each year, according to analysts.

By the end of June, Chinese lenders held 38.6 trillion yuan in outstanding individual mortgage loans, statistics showed.

The support measures for the property sector echoed calls from the Political Bureau of the Communist Party of China Central Committee in July, which urged an adaption to a new situation, where major changes have taken place in the relationship between supply and demand in China's real estate market.

Over the past two months, Chinese authorities have launched measures ranging from lowering interest rates to easing restrictions on home purchases in a bid to bolster the stagnant property sector.

Last year was a tough one for the sector, with property investment falling 10 percent on a yearly basis, the first decline since records began in 1999.

China's September manufacturing PMI hit 50.2; its first time in positive territory since April: NBS

China’s official manufacturing purchasing managers' index (PMI) for September came in at 50.2, its first time in positive territory since April, after a consecutive increase over the last four months, reads a National Bureau of Statistics (NBS) release on Saturday, reflecting recovery momentum across the country’s manufacturing sector.

Manufacturing is a vital pillar in China’s economy, thus the September manufacturing PMI signaled the recovery of the general macroeconomy, Li Changan, a professor from the Academy of China Open Economy Studies of the University of International Business and Economics, told the Global Times on Saturday.

Zhao Qinghe, a senior statistician from the NBS, said that recovering market demand had accelerated business activities across the manufacturing sector. In September, the production index came in at 52.7 percent, up 0.8 percentage point month-on-month; new order index recorded at 50.5 percent, up 0.3 percentage point month-on-month.

Specifically, PMI readings for equipment manufacturing hit 50.6 percent, high-tech manufacturing hit 50.1 percent and consumer goods manufacturing hit 51.3 percent, all returning to the expansion territory.

However, the increasing large commodities price and enterprises’ active purchasing lifted the general price index for the manufacturing sector. NBS data showed that the index of raw material purchasing in September reached 59.4 percent, and index of producer price reached 53.5 percent, all hitting a high for 2023.

Zhao noted that ‘China’s manufacturing sector recovery is still facing challenges from fierce competition, high cost and intensive financing, while various policy support measures will further push the momentum of overall economy recovery.

“The steady increase of manufacturing sector in recent months reflected that government’s policy support measures targeting the sector are taking effect, and have been boosted by the government’s focus on fostering advanced manufacturing technologies,” Li said.

In August, profit of China's industrial enterprises above designated size bounced back from negative to positive territory, recording a 17.2 percent year-on-year increase, the NBS revealed on Wednesday.

Observers said that PMI usually reflects market activities which will flow through to private sector profits.

The NBS also revealed the PMI for non-manufacturing in September which stood at 51.7, up 0.7 percentage points from August. The ongoing Golden Week holidays for the Mid-Autumn Festival and the National Day showed strong momentum across China’s consumption market.

As an important phase of the whole industrial chain, domestic consumption which is under recovery will further advance a f manufacturing recovery, Li noted.

China is considering holding degree holders who use artificial intelligence (AI) to ghostwrite their theses legally responsible. The draft of the Degree Law was submitted to the Standing Committee of the 14th National People's Congress, China's top legislature, for deliberation on Monday.

The draft lays out legal responsibilities for actions such as degree holders using or impersonating another's identity to gain admission qualifications, employing artificial intelligence to author thesis papers, and institutions granting degrees unlawfully, as reported by the media on Monday. 

Academic misconduct includes plagiarism, forgery, data falsification, using artificial intelligence to produce a thesis, impersonating another's identity to obtain admission qualifications, and securing admission qualifications and graduation certificates through illicit means like favoritism and cheating. The draft also addresses other illegal or irregular behaviors that, when exhibited during the study period, should prevent the awarding of a degree.

The draft states that if an individual who has already obtained a degree is found to have used illegal means to do so, the degree-granting institution must revoke the degree certificate. This decision should be made following a review by the degree evaluation committee.

Odd white dwarf found with mostly oxygen atmosphere

White dwarfs — the exposed cores of dead stars — are the last place astronomers expected to find an oxygen atmosphere. Yet that’s exactly what recently turned up, providing researchers a rare peek inside the core of a massive star and raising questions about how such an oddball could have formed.

Most stars die by gently casting the bulk of their gas into space, leaving behind a dense, hot core. Heavy elements such as carbon and oxygen sink to the core’s center while hydrogen and helium float to the surface. But a newly discovered white dwarf, about 1,200 light-years away in the constellation Draco, has no hydrogen or helium at its surface. Its atmosphere is instead dominated by oxygen, researchers report in the April 1 Science.
“We only found one, so it is a rare event,” says study coauthor Kepler de Souza Oliveira Filho, an astronomer at the Federal University of Rio Grande do Sul in Porto Alegre, Brazil. But, he says, “every theory must be able to explain all events, even the rare ones.”

Hydrogen and helium blanket most white dwarfs, hiding what lies beneath. Here, astronomers have “a window into the core of a star that we didn’t have before,” says Patrick Dufour, an astrophysicist at the University of Montreal.

While oxygen dominates this white dwarf’s atmosphere, neon and magnesium come in second and third — a clue that the original star was much bigger than our sun. Big stars can crank up their core temperatures high enough to fuse progressively heavier elements. A star between about six and 10 times as massive as the sun ends up with a core made of mostly oxygen, neon and magnesium — precisely what Filho and colleagues found. But there’s a problem: Such a white dwarf should be a bit heavier than our sun, and this newly discovered misfit appears to have about half as much mass.

A nearby stellar companion could have siphoned gas off the dying star, starving the white dwarf of mass, the researchers suggest. Thermonuclear excavation during the star’s end game could also lead to an underweight white dwarf. If enough hydrogen piled up on the core, it might have triggered a runaway nuclear explosion that shaved off the white dwarf’s outer layers.

While plausible, it’s hard to see how that could remove half of the white dwarf’s mass, Dufour says. “That’s very strange,” he says. “It could work, but I doubt it would leave a low-mass white dwarf.”
In 2007, Dufour and colleagues reported a similar strange sighting: several white dwarfs whose atmospheres were loaded with carbon instead of hydrogen and helium. Those also appeared to be missing some mass, he says, though the problem was found to lie not with the stars but with the mass estimates. The white dwarfs are heavier than initially thought, and Dufour now suspects that each one arose from a collision between two white dwarfs.

It’s too early to draw strong conclusions from a single oxygen-laden white dwarf. “There are lots of open questions before we can say that this changes our view of white dwarf evolution,” Dufour says. “This white dwarf might only be a freak…. Although often in science, it’s the exception that makes you understand a great deal later on.”

Possible perp found in mystery of Milky Way’s missing galaxy pals

SAN DIEGO — The long-standing mystery of the Milky Way’s missing satellite galaxies has a credible culprit, new research suggests. Supernovas, the vigorous explosions of massive stars, might have shoved much of the matter surrounding our galaxy deep into space, preventing a horde of tiny companion galaxies from forming in the first place.

Millions of teeny galaxies should be buzzing around the Milky Way, according to theories about how galaxies evolve, but observations have turned up only a few dozen (SN: 9/19/15, p. 6). And the brightest of those that have been found are lightweights compared with what theorists expect to find. But new computer simulations designed to track the growth of galaxies down to the level of individual stars reveal the critical role that supernovas might play in resolving these conundrums.
Philip Hopkins, an astrophysicist at Caltech, presented the results June 13 during a news briefing at a meeting of the American Astronomical Society.

“Galaxies don’t just form stars and sit there,” Hopkins said. “If you [add] up all the energy that supernovae emitted during a galaxy’s lifetime, it’s greater than the gravitational energy holding the galaxy together. You cannot ignore it.”

Simulations are typically limited by computing power, and efforts to simulate galaxy evolution have to brush over some details. For instance, rather than capture everything that’s going on in a galaxy, simulations slap on the additive effects of supernovas in an ad hoc fashion. These limitations don’t fully capture all the physics of stellar winds and supernova shocks that ripple through a galaxy.

Hopkins’ simulations grow a galaxy organically within a computer, tracing the evolution of a system such as the Milky Way over 13 billion years. Within a massive virtual blob of dark matter — the elusive substance thought to bind galaxies together — gas collects and fragments into stellar nurseries. Stars are born and die in this digital universe. A volley of life-ending explosions from the most massive of these stars lead to a turbulent galactic history, Hopkins finds.

“As these stars form rapidly in the early universe, they also live briefly and explode and die violently, ejecting material far from the galaxy,” he said. “They’re not just getting rid of gas.” They’re stirring up the dark matter as well, preventing a multitude of satellite galaxies from forming, and whittling away at those few that survive. “It’s not until quite late times … that [the galaxy] settles down and forms what we would call a recognizable galaxy today,” Hopkins said.
The idea that stellar tantrums could chip away at the gas and dark matter around a galaxy is not new, says Janice Lee, an astronomer at the Space Telescope Science Institute in Baltimore. But Hopkins’ simulations bring a lot more detail to that story and show that it’s a plausible reason for our galaxy’s satellite shortfall.

Before declaring that the mystery of the missing satellite galaxies is solved, however, astronomers need to run a few more checks against reality, says Lee. There are still assumptions in the calculations about how energy from dying stars interacts with interstellar gas, for example. The precise details of that interaction can affect how many stellar runts versus behemoths form in star clusters.

NASA’s James Webb Space Telescope, scheduled to launch in 2018, could probe star clusters in several relatively nearby galaxies, she says. Those observations could be compared with virtual clusters that appear in the simulations to see how close they match the real universe.
